A whiskey distillery tour offers an immersive experience into the world of whiskey making, allowing visitors to witness firsthand the intricate processes involved in crafting this distilled spirit. During a typical tour, guests are guided through the distillery, learning about the history, ingredients, and techniques used in whiskey production. They may have the opportunity to observe the mashing, fermentation, distillation, and aging stages, gaining insights into the art and science behind whiskey making. Many distilleries also offer tastings, providing visitors with the chance to sample different whiskeys and appreciate their unique flavors and characteristics.

Whiskey, a distilled alcoholic beverage made from fermented grain mash, finds its home in various regions worldwide, with Tennessee being one of them. Whiskey brands from Tennessee have gained prominence for their unique characteristics, contributing to the state’s rich whiskey-making heritage.
The distinct flavor profile of Tennessee whiskey stems from the Lincoln County Process, a unique filtration method that mellows the whiskey through sugar maple charcoal. This process imparts a smooth, balanced taste, setting Tennessee whiskey apart from its counterparts. Moreover, the aging process in charred oak barrels further enhances its complexity and depth of flavor.
A Tennessee mule is a classic cocktail made with whiskey, ginger beer, and lime juice. It is a refreshing and flavorful drink that is perfect for any occasion. The whiskey provides a strong backbone to the drink, while the ginger beer adds a spicy sweetness. The lime juice adds a bright and citrusy flavor that balances out the sweetness of the ginger beer.
